Taking a stroll through Anderson Japanese Gardens is a “must” every fall. The peaceful, natural environment provides a great escape – especially during a pandemic.  To enhance the experience, the Garden will feature Soundscapes for Strolling, featuring live instrumental music in the Garden of Reflection every Thursday afternoon in October.  Musicians will play from 3pm-5pm.  The experience is FREE for Garden Members and the cost of regular Garden admission for non-members.

October 15:        Joel Ross, Pianist, Rockford Symphony Orchestra; Light Classics & Jazz                                                   Standards

October 22:        Stirling String Quartet; Past & Current Music Academy & RYSO Students

October 29:        Juliann & Graham of J&G; Immersive Sound, Chant & Spoken Word
